Magic Layers Asset Refresh Sprint (5-7 days)
A five to seven day engagement that converts flat client images into named, transparent layers, enabling creative repurposing without original source files and integrating with Photoshop, Figma, and Canva.
- Client provides at least 30 flat PNG or JPEG images for layer separation
- Agency has an active Magic Layers account with sufficient credits (Basic plan at $29/month for 400 credits)
- Access to Photoshop, Figma, or Canva for final layer integration
- Client approves a target layer count per image (e.g., 4-8 layers) and optional separation descriptions
- Clear delivery format agreed: named transparent PNGs plus a base image
- 1.Set up Magic Layers account and review the separation interface, noting input parameters like image file, target layer count, and optional separation description
- 2.Run a pilot on 5 sample images to calibrate layer counts and separation quality
- 3.Document the optimal settings for different image types (e.g., product shots vs. marketing banners)
- 1.Receive and catalog client images into a structured folder system
- 2.Upload first batch of images to Magic Layers, specifying target layer counts and separation descriptions where needed
- 3.Download the base image and named transparent PNGs for each processed asset
- 1.Continue processing remaining images in batches, monitoring credit usage against the 400-credit Basic plan
- 2.Verify that text, subjects, decorations, and backgrounds are correctly separated into named layers
- 3.Flag any images that require re-processing or manual adjustment
- 1.Organize the delivered layers into a labeled folder system per client asset
- 2.Integrate the layered PNGs into Photoshop, Figma, or Canva to confirm compatibility
- 3.Create a simple reuse guide for the client, explaining how to edit text or swap backgrounds in their preferred tool
- 1.Deliver the structured folder system and reuse guide to the client
- 2.Conduct a walkthrough session demonstrating how to repurpose a layered asset for a new campaign
- 3.Collect client feedback and adjust the workflow for future batches
With a $1,800 productized fee and a tool cost of $29 per month (covering the credit usage for 30 images), the agency retains over 98% margin on the tool cost. Even if the client requires 600 layers, the Pro plan at $79 still leaves a margin above $1,700 per engagement.
